Help Build the Quality Foundation of a Brand-New High-Tech Facility
Kelly® is hiring Receiving Quality Control Inspectors for an exciting direct-hire opportunity at a brand-new electronics manufacturing facility in Salt Lake City, Utah.
In this role, you’ll inspect electronic and mechanical components used to manufacture advanced radio communication technology designed to remain operational when traditional infrastructure is unavailable. These products primarily support military applications, along with other industries that depend on secure and reliable communication.
You’ll inspect incoming materials and components, document results, identify quality concerns, and collaborate with Production, Engineering, Purchasing, and suppliers to prevent nonconforming materials from entering the manufacturing process.
This is an excellent opportunity for a detail-oriented quality professional who wants to join a growing high-tech organization, help establish strong inspection processes, and build a long-term career in electronics quality.

What You’ll Be Doing- Performing incoming, in-process, and product inspections on electronic and mechanical components
- Inspecting electronic cables, GPS devices, Wi-Fi dongles, connectors, mechanical enclosures, shields, and other critical parts
- Inspecting incoming raw materials, purchased components, subassemblies, and finished products
- Conducting dimensional, visual, functional, fit, and documentation inspections
- Performing fit checks to confirm parts assemble and function properly
- Completing First Article Inspections on components and subassemblies
- Using calipers, micrometers, microscopes, multimeters, gauges, and other inspection tools
- Reading and interpreting blueprints, drawings, specifications, schematics, and part documentation
- Reviewing basic printed circuit board and printed wiring assembly documentation
- Confirming that materials meet customer, engineering, and internal quality requirements
- Determining whether parts are acceptable, nonconforming, or require additional evaluation
- Verifying that the correct inspection procedures, methods, equipment, and tooling are being used
- Preparing accurate incoming and in-process inspection reports
- Entering inspection results and quality information into company computer systems
- Using programs such as Oracle, Excel, and Google Workspace
- Maintaining quality records, traceability documentation, inspection results, and supporting files
- Identifying defects, anomalies, failures, and potential quality risks
- Investigating quality concerns and communicating findings to Quality, Production, Engineering, Purchasing, and suppliers
- Supporting corrective actions, process improvements, and product-quality improvements
- Escalating inspection concerns promptly to prevent nonconforming materials from moving into production
- Supporting continuous-improvement initiatives related to product quality, inspection efficiency, and workflow
- Maintaining an organized, clean, and safe inspection area
